Τhe Accident Management Coordinator holds a pivotal position within our organization, tasked with the management of processes associated with accident management ,Own Damage (OD) domains. This role is fundamental in ensuring that all incidents related to accident management are handled consistently, guaranteeing optimal service for drivers while managing costs effectively for Ayvens.
Key Responsibilities:
- Monitor the initiation and conclusion of damaged car repairs aiming to enhance the driver experience.
- Strategically minimize the time and cost required for the repair of damages.
- Ensure the creation of qualitative claim files to streamline the claims handling process.
- Provide timely support and relevant information to drivers involved in accidents.
- Monitor partner actions in accordance with their Service Level Agreements (SLAs).
- Channel damage assessments towards the preferred suppliers network.
- Conclude theft and total loss cases within the agreed timeframe.
- Handle and resolve driver complaints efficiently.
- Collaborate with all departments to ensure efficient handling of client requests.
Qualifications and Skills:
- A university degree in a relevant field.
- Proficiency in MS Office suite.
- Excellent command of the English language, both verbal and written.
- Knowledge of the insurance/automotive market is advantageous.
- Strong organizational skills with meticulous attention to detail.
- Customer-oriented mindset, dedicated to enhancing customer satisfaction.
- Results-oriented approach to achieve set objectives.
- Exceptional interpersonal and negotiation sk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a collaborative team environment.

With over 3.4 million vehicles managed across more than 42 countries, we provide full-service leasing, flexible subscription services, fleet management services and multi-mobility solutions to customers of all sizes, including large corporates, SMEs, professionals, and private individuals. By leveraging our unique position to lead the way to net zero and further shape the digital transformation of the industry, we are well-positioned to meet the evolving mobility needs of our clients and provide them with the solutions they need to thrive.
